dc.description.abstractThe research investigates various factors that influence student class attendance in a Hospitality Management module. Using survey questionnaires, the research aimed to determine factors that may negatively affect class attendance of first year students. The research was embarked upon to determine reasons for students not attending class as a possible variable for low throughput and high dropout rates. The research findings will indicate which factors affects class attendance the most in a Hospitality Management module. The data was analysed according to biographical information, external factors influencing class attendance, students’ motivation, respondents’ perceptions and internal factors to the institution. The biographical information does not play a factor in absenteeism. External factors do play a very small factor in non-attendance, what but no a significant role. The research found that motivation, respondents’ perceptions and internal factors to the institution do play a role in non-attendance in group of students.en_US
